数据库期末试题(附答案).pdf
《数据库期末试题(附答案).pdf》由会员分享,可在线阅读,更多相关《数据库期末试题(附答案).pdf(7页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、 数据库原理课程考试模拟题四 一、单项选择题(在每小题的四个备选答案中选出一个正确答案。本题共 16 分,每小题 1 分)1.在数据库中,下列说法()是不正确的。A数据库中没有数据冗余 B数据库具有较高的数据独立性 C数据库能为各种用户共享 D数据库加强了数据保护 2.按照传统的数据模型分类,数据库系统可以分为()三种类型。A大型、中型和小型 B西文、中文和兼容 C层次、网状和关系 D数据、图形和多媒体 3.在数据库的三级模式结构中,()是用户与数据库系统的接口,是用户用到的那部分数据的描述。A外模式 B内模式 C存储模式 D模式 4.下面选项中不是关系的基本特征的是()。A.不同的列应有不同
2、的数据类型 B.不同的列应有不同的列名 C.没有行序和列序 D.没有重复元组 5.SQL 语言具有两种使用方式,分别称为交互式 SQL 和()。A提示式 SQL B多用户 SQL C嵌入式 SQL D解释式 SQL 6.设关系模式 R(ABCD),F 是 R 上成立的 FD 集,F=AB,BC,则(BD)+为()。ABCD BBC CABC DC 7.E-R 图是数据库设计的工具之一,它适用于建立数据库的()。A概念模型 B逻辑模型 C结构模型 D物理模型 8.若关系模式 R(ABCD)已属于 3NF,下列说法中()是正确的。A它一定消除了插入和删除异常 B仍存在一定的插入和删除异常 C一定属
3、于 BCNF DA 和 C 都是 9.解决并发操作带来的数据不一致性普遍采用()。A封锁技术 B恢复技术 C存取控制技术 D协商 10.数据库管理系统通常提供授权功能来控制不同用户访问数据的权限,这主要是为了实现数据库的()。A可靠性 B一致性 C完整性 D安全性 11.一个事务一旦完成全部操作后,它对数据库的所有更新应永久地反映在数据库中,不会丢失。这是指事务的()。A.原子性 B.一致性 C.隔离性 D.持久性 12.在数据库中,软件错误属于()。A.事务故障 B.系统故障 C.介质故障 D.活锁 13.在通常情况下,下面的关系中不可以作为关系数据库的关系是()。AR1(学生号,学生名,性
4、别)BR2(学生号,学生名,班级号)CR3(学生号,学生名,宿舍号)DR4(学生号,学生名,简历)14.有 12 个实体类型,并且它们之间存在着 15 个不同的二元联系,其中 4 个是 1:1 联系类型,5 个是 1:N 2/7 联系类型,6 个 M:N 联系类型,那么根据转换规则,这个 ER 结构转换成的关系模式有()。A17 个 B18 个 C23 个 D27 个 15.数据库中存放三级模式结构定义的是()。ADBS BDB CDD DDFD 16.DBMS 通过()来保证数据库中的数据是正确的,避免非法的不符合语义的错误数据的输入和输出。A完整性检查 B安全性检查 C语法检查 D合法检查
5、 二、填空题(本题共 10 分,每题各 1 分)1 是位于用户和操作系统之间的一层数据管理软件,它为用户或应用程序提供访问 DB 的方法。2 表示某一加工处理过程的输入或输出数据。3DBS 运行的最小逻辑工作单元是 。4系统能把数据库从被破坏、不正确的状态,恢复到最近一个正确的状态,DBMS 的这种能力称为 。5数据库的并发操作通常会带来三个问题:丢失更新,读脏数据,以及 。6如果关系模式 R 是 1NF,且每个属性都不传递依赖于 R 的候选键,则称 R 是 的模式。7关系模型的实体完整性是指 。8外模式/模式映象为数据库提供了_ 数据独立性。9设计全局 ER 模式时需要消除的冲突有:属性冲突
6、、命名冲突和 。10需求说明书的主要内容是 和数据字典。三、简答题(本题共 16 分,每小题 4 分)1.简述封锁技术中常用的两种锁。2SQL 的数据更新包括哪三种操作?分别用什么语句实现?3简述采用 ER 方法的数据库概念设计过程。4.简述关系数据库中的几种关键码。四、计算题(本题共 14 分,每小题 7 分)1设关系模式 R(ABCD),R 分解成=AB,ACD,BCD。如果 R 上成立的函数依赖集 F=AC,DC,BDA,那么相对于 F 是否无损分解?是否保持函数依赖?2设有两个关系如下图所示,试计算:(1)R S (2)R S R B C S C D b 2 2 6 a d d a 5
7、 8 7 c 五、查询设计题(本题共 24 分,每小题 3 分)设有如下关系模式:学生关系:S(SNO(学号),SNAME(姓名),SEX(性别),SDEPT(系别),PROV(省区)3/7 选课关系:SC(SNO(学号),CNO(课程号),G(成绩)课程关系:C(CNO(课程号),CNAME(课程名),CDEPT(开课系别),TNAME(教师名)请用关系代数表达式写出(1)(3):(1)查询来自北京的学生的姓名和系别(2)查询英语系的学生所选修课程的课程名和成绩(3)查询选修课程包含 Luo 老师所授课程的学生学号 请用 SQL 语言描述(4)(8):(4)查询计算机系男同学的学号、姓名和省
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数据库 期末 试题 答案
限制150内